%N Integers n such that for all i > n the largest prime factor of i(i+1)(i+2)(i+3)(i+4)(i+5) exceeds the largest prime factor of n(n+1)(n+2)(n+3)(n+4)(n+5).
%C Heuristics show that these terms are valid, but a strict proof is yet to be done.
